Exactly How Cold Laser Therapy Works



To comprehend how cold laser therapy works, you require to realize the essential concepts of how light power engages with biological tissues. Cold laser therapy, additionally called low-level laser treatment (LLLT), utilizes specific wavelengths of light to permeate the skin and target hidden cells. Unlike the intense lasers used in surgical procedures, cold lasers give off low levels of light that do not generate heat or create damage to the cells.

When these gentle light waves get to the cells, they're taken in by components called chromophores, such as cytochrome c oxidase in mitochondria. This absorption causes a series of organic responses, consisting of raised cellular energy production and the release of nitric oxide, which enhances blood flow and reduces inflammation.

Furthermore, the light energy can also stimulate the production of adenosine triphosphate (ATP), the power money of cells, assisting in mobile repair service and regeneration processes.

In essence, cold laser therapy harnesses the power of light energy to promote healing and relieve pain in a non-invasive and mild way.

Therapeutic Impacts



Understanding the healing impacts of cold laser therapy includes acknowledging exactly how the improved mobile metabolism and anti-inflammatory residential or commercial properties contribute to its positive end results on biological tissues.

When the cold laser is related to the damaged area, it promotes the mitochondria within the cells, leading to boosted production of adenosine triphosphate (ATP), which is vital for cellular function and repair work. This boost in mobile power accelerates the healing procedure by advertising cells regrowth and reducing swelling.

Additionally, the anti-inflammatory homes of cold laser treatment help to lower discomfort and swelling in the targeted area. By hindering inflammatory mediators and promoting the release of anti-inflammatory cytokines, cold laser therapy help in alleviating discomfort and improving the overall healing reaction.

This decrease in inflammation not just offers instant relief yet likewise sustains long-lasting tissue repair work.
